759)   Our present is not grateful for the past labours which made  this possible. That being the case, how can we complain against  the ingratitude of others? µ

760)   Gratitude is the present appreciating our past endeavours  that made the present possible. µ

761)   Even when we recognise our strengths in the past, we refuse  to be grateful for our past weaknesses that brought catastro-phes over our heads while the truth is our present owes as much to them. µ

762)   In this sense, gratitude is the inability to be sorry for our low past. µ

763)   By extension, we can say gratitude is our inability to complain against others. µ

764)   Refusing to complain, refraining from regret, we recognise the Hand of God in every act. Recognition of His Presence is Grati- tude. &

783)   A prayer is answered by the deity to which it is addressed. But  alongside there is another truth of the force of personality at the point  of its full organisation which has almost the power of a deity. Who has  answered the prayer varies. µ

784)   All prayers within the limits of this personality are, at their peak, answered by this organisation. Those which lie outside this limit are answered by the deity through this organisation.µ

785)   Prayers that remain unanswered either do not rise to the level of this personality organisation or do not reach the deity breaking through this limit. µ

786)   There are intense prayers which can reach any height but remain unanswered because within the personality there will be  another element cancelling the prayer. µ
